Na’Abba Recounts Experience With DSS

... Says Self Determination Is Not About Dismemberment Of Nigeria

by NewsDen Publishers
August 18, 2020
in NEWS, NIGERIA
0
Na’Abba Recounts Experience With DSS
Share on FacebookShare on TwitterShare on WhatsappSend to Email

FORMER Speaker, House of Representatives, Ghali Umar Na’Abba on Monday night, recounted his experience in the hands of Department of State Services (DSS), Abuja.

The former lawmaker who is the co-Chairman of the National Consultative Front (NCFront), was invited for questioning based on a national television progeamme broadcast last Thursday, said he made it clear that self determination in his own contest was not about dismemberment of Nigeria.

In the interview, he had criticised President Muhammadu Buhari’s administration for allegedly not handling the country’s affairs effectively and was invited by DSS, after which, he granted interview to journalists.

“In my address, I used the words ‘failed state’ and ‘self-determination’.

“When we say out words, what we mean may be different from what other persons perceive, and that was what happened.

“Self-determination, simply in our own context, means Nigerians must be allowed to live the way they want to live.

“It does not mean the dismemberment of the country.

“A lot of times, from security point of view when you say self-determination, it is perceived to mean that it is the dismemberment of the country; which is not so; this needed clarification.

“A failed state is any state that cannot provide a lot of services.

“I did not disown anything I said; I will never mince my words.

“Whatever I see as the truth, I say it; and that is what I said in my interview and said during the press conference; and, I can never say anything that is not the truth.

“What happened was there were certain words that appeared in my address and interview which needed some clarifications and which clarification I made.

“We were both satisfied with what happened; we advised one another.

“The DSS has its own job and its own experience; I too have my own vocation and my own experience; we felt highly enriched by our experiences.

“That is how things are supposed to be; it went successfully.

“I enjoyed my stay there; I had no problems with the way they received me.”
